Report: MSU basketball to play preseason scrimmage against Tennessee

Before the Spartans officially tip off the 2022-23 season, they’ll head to Knoxville, Tenn. for a preseason scrimmage.

Mike Wilson of The Knoxville News Sentinel reported on Saturday morning that Michigan State and Tennessee have agreed to a multi-year, home-and-home closed-door scrimmage series. The Spartans will head to Tennessee this year, and the Volunteers will come to East Lansing, Mich. next year.

There isn’t a known date of this scrimmage at this time, and as always this will be closed to the public by NCAA rules. In the past, stats and notes have leaked from these preseason scrimmages so I’m sure we will get details after the scrimmage has been played.

Michigan State officially opens the season on Nov. 7 against Northern Arizona. The Spartans will also play Grand Valley State on Nov. 1 in a preseason exhibition game.
